On the TT/arm/cartridge hierarchy thing, I was fiddling with cartridges this weekend and thought I'd try the opposite extreme from the cheap TT/expensive cartridge mismatch, just for haha's. While switching from one fancy MC to another I slipped my old ADC XLM MkII in the system.

Now this was about as ridiculous as the Koetsu Tiger Eye/Denon setup. $3900 TT, $3900 tonearm, 25-year-old MM cartridge that was about $140 back in the day. (It does have a fairly low-hours stylus, though it hasn't been used in about 18 months.)

I gave the old XLM quite a scare. First, she got mounted on this high-falutin rig. Then I brought out the alignment protractor. She had never seen one of those before, and she didn't like it one bit! Crookedest cantilever I've ever seen but there was enough play in the slots to line things up, more or less.

I pulled out some backup copies of one or two LPs and -OOPS! Don't forget to bypass the stepups. Can you say overload?

So how did this nonsensical mismatch sound. Damned impressive! Having lived with three top quality MC's the weaknesses were obvious of course, no highs, not much bass, kinda slow and sludgy. But it was also dynamic, musical and very listenable. If I had never heard the MC's I might go some time with the XLM before noticing what was missing.

Without coaching him I asked Paul which idiotic mismatch he'd rather live with, this cheap cartridge/expensive rig or the Shelter 901/cheap rig we listened to for a couple of weeks before our Teres showed up. With no hesitation he pointed at the good rig/cheap cartridge combo. "This makes music," he said, "the Shelter just showed up the flaws of the inadequate TT and arm."

It was silly, but it was fun to demonstrate the truth of the hierarchy Twl recommends. Balance is best of course, but if you must mismatch for a time, get the best rig you can afford and skimp (to a point) on the cartridge.

Artar, the discussion of DC vs AC motors is a lengthy one.

Primarily, it has to do with AC "cogging" vs DC "non-cogging" regarding the way the motors work.

"Cogging" is the result of the motor behavior when the individual poles of the motor pass the magnets. A 4-pole motor will have a "surge and lag" effect as each pole passes the magnetic parts of the motor that can be noticeable. AC motor makers have increased their number of poles to reduce this effect, and commonly now use 24-pole motors. The effect is reduced, but not entirely gone.

AC Sychronous motors use the AC line frequency(60Hz) that is generated by the power company to use as a speed reference that keeps their motor speed "constant", similar to an electric clock. Since it locks on the line frequency, and not the voltage level, it can remain constant even during fluctuations of voltage. It is a commonly used type of drive for most of the lower cost turntables, and is even used fairly commonly in expensive turntables.

DC motors do not have a cogging effect, but since there is no "line frequency" in DC, there is no reference to "lock" on the speed like an AC motor does. DC motors are speed controlled by the voltage level. So, the DC motors must have some kind of controller, or the TT will constantly undergo minor slowing as you play the LP, due to drag forces. The "best" kind of controller for the DC motors is a subject of great debate.

Obviously, a "quartz lock" or other "hunting" type of controller that uses a strobe as a reference can have the effects of quick speed up/slow down known as "hunting". This is not good. Teres has developed a controller which uses strobe reference on the platter, which senses variations and applies corrections in a very slow manner, which is not really audible. Some may argue this and claim it is audible. The other method is to use a relatively non-referenced controller which sets speed as a constant, and hopes that nothing really slows the platter down along the way. Any slowdowns with this type of controller will be additive all along the side of the LP being played. Some will argue that this is not noticeable, but others say it is. In either case, the platter momentum is critical to the controller not having to make corrections, or not slowing the platter down during play. Neither of these systems is perfect, and the AC synchronous system is not perfect. Nothing is perfect. Since the ear is most senstive to minor speed variations occuring in a rapid manner(flutter), we strive to minimize flutter, but the methods we use may result in more slower variations(wow). "Wow"(in small levels) is less noticeable to the ear. So, the DC motor application is used to provide the smoothest results in flutter, but may have a bit more wow, or a bit more gradual slowdown, depending upon the type of controller used. In addition, belt stretch and rebound, belt slip, and other things may enter into the equation. It is a difficult engineering task to get close to perfection in this area, and there is no solid consensus on the best method to use. However, it is generally conceded that a well implemented DC motor can sound better than an AC synchronous. The individual TT makers use their ideas of what the best method is, and the user must decide which he prefers sonically. Most of the best units are very very good, and will not intrude into the listening experience noticeably.

Dan_Ed, the lead loading in the Teres acrylic platter could have the effect of improved perceived bass response.

Essentially, the greater rotational mass will improve the ability of the platter to retain its speed through the tall steep peaks that are present in the bass information in the record groove. This will be percieved as faster and better dynamics in these frequencies, and will add impact.

Generally in belt drive systems, high platter mass is desirable. Affording to buy it may be another matter entirely.

I think that people who seriously cares about musical reproduction at home, has to have as their main priority to extract the signal from the LP with the utmost accuracy possible. In other words, the main priority should be the phono cartridge, with the arm and turntable as secondary priorities, which of course must also be taken into account. This is easy to understand if we consider that phono cartridges, as well as speakers, are transducers whose function is to convert the audio signal from one type of energy (mechanical) to another type (electrical) and viceversa. This is the most difficult and important task to be done.

With this in mind, the cartridge should be selected first, regarding important parameters such as: The basic principle of operation (MM or MC); the type of internal magnet (smarium-cobalt, neodymium, rare earths, alnico, etc.); the type of stylus, material and design of the cantilever; suspension, cartridge body, and several minor factors. All the former will determine how accurate will be the "translation" performed by the cartridge itself when reading the LP information. Obviously the cartridge will operate into a given "environment", consisting of the arm and the turntable, and this environment must be optimized as far as possible to facilitate the cartridge's job. However, as I said before, this environment should not be the goal in itself, but only a mean to the main purpose. If the job is done correctly, the result will be a good synergy between all three elements, leading to an natural and musical reproduction.

Continuing with this reasoning, the second priority would be to choose an arm that makes the best match with the cartridge. Any deviation from the optimal matching will mean a degradation in the sound to be reproduced. The third priority then must be the turntable, which is the "environment" into which these couple will dance.

If the turntable was the first step, this would put us into an extremely limited condition, as there is no perfect universal turntable as yet. Let us suppose that we begin our setup by choosing a turntable designed by the suspension principle, this feature alone would not allow us to use a heavy tonearm, if this turntable was a Linn (for instance) it would be unable to use as SME V, because as we all know there is no synergy between them. On the other hand, if the turntable had an acrilic/wood plate, there are in fact cartridge/tonearm combos that sound better in this type of plates. On the contrary if the plate was metallic, then the combo to be used would be different, and this would prevent us to freely choose the cartridge/tonearm. If the turntable uses a metallic armboard, then the chosen combo will have to be different from that with acrilic armboard. This means that nobody would be able to openly choose the cartridge and arm they wish, as the turntable itself would define the rest of the components, which will again put us into a less than ideal situation.

Lets us now suppose that we begin our setup in the order Cartridge-Tonearm-Turntable. We would begin by choosing the cartridge that we know will get the optimal quality in LP musical reproduction. Up to this point we shouldn't care about the turntable that will be chosen. Then we would choose the tonearm that best complements the cartridge, still disregarding the turntable. Once cartridge/tonearm duo is defined, then and only then we are in position to choose the turntable that helps us to preserve the signal quality of the transducer and tonearm.

The tonearm and turntable are really a "necessary evil", because without them the transducer is unable to operate. However, it's important to remember that it is the transducer itself who has the main responsibility in LP reproduction, and the final result will depend firstly in this transducer quality, and secondly in the quality and matching of its partners. 50% is on the record. It contains only vertical information, when it is stationary. The turntable provides all the time-domain information, as it spins the record under the stylus.

In addition to the time-domain issue, the turntable provides some other extremely important attributes, without the proper function thereof, the cartridge cannot work up to its capabilities. This would relate to the main bearing's ability to maintain stability in the lateral plane. If the main bearing allows movements to occur within it(from vibration or other sources), the platter can be moved microscopically laterally, and therefore influence the critical juncture of the record/stylus contact. The record information contains modulations on the order of angstrom measurement. If the main bearing allows the platter to move, even slightly laterally, this will cause some of the record information to pass under the stylus without deflecting it(therefore losing information), or cause the record information to pass under the stylus and deflecting it too much(therefore causing overmodulation). Both of these conditions cause our cartridge to not perform as intended, regardless of how great the cartridge is, or how perfectly it is matched to the arm. No turntable does this function perfectly, as yet. The better turntables will allow the cartridge/tonearm combination to perform at a better level, because they are presented with the record information from the groove in a more stable manner, both vertically, horizontally, and in the time domain. Without this proper stability of the record groove, no stylus/cartridge can work at its best, and therefore will perform at less than what was intended. To get the best information retrieval from any cartridge you select, the record groove must be passed under the stylus with the most stability possible, in all three planes: vertical, horizontal, and time-domain(speed). Then the tonearm and cartridge combination can begin to do their work properly. Without this, they will never even approach their potentials. And this is why the turntable must be considered primary in the order of importance in the analog chain. Notice I did not say that it is the only important thing. Simply that the foundation must be laid before the roof goes on.

I maintain that the transducer is limited by the turntable, and that in real-world situations, a moderately good transducer working at maximim performance on a top-notch turntable, will outperform a top-notch cartridge working at reduced performance on a moderately good turntable.

You have given no reasons to back up your opinion, other than your opinion. I have heard your argument a million times and it has never "held water" yet.

I state that a cartridge which has more musical information properly fed into it, will outperform a more capable cartridge which has less musical information fed into it less properly. I backed up my case with reasons for my position. This would clearly place the turntable higher in the order of importance. I understand you disagree.

Tell me why.

I would totally agree with you, if your statement was "A better cartridge will sound better than a lesser cartridge, on the same turntable(so long as they match well with the tonearm)." However, when the discussion leads to the matter at hand, that is where we part company.

Regarding musical reproduction, it is understood that more recorded information getting into the system is paramount to improving the music. Correct me if I am wrong about that.

If a cartridge retrieves less musical information(or lost information, or speed corrupted information) from the recording(due to a flaw in the turntable performance), it cannot sound better. It can sound "smoother" or "flatter response", etc. but it cannot sound "better" because there is less musical information entering the system, or there is flawed musical information entering the system.

Conversely, if the cartridge retrieves more musical information from the recording(even if the cartridge is of lesser quality), it will sound better(more musical) because more of the music enters the system.

Certainly, this music can be affected by the quality of the transducer, but at least the music makes it into the system.

This is my point. A quality transducer cannot produce music that is lost or corrupted by a turntable flaw. Improving the transducer on a given turntable will improve the sound only to the degree that the turntable is capable of producing. To improve the sound further will require a better turntable. Once this point is reached, no transducer in the world will improve the music, until the turntable is improved.
